1. 首页
  2. 主题
  3. Go问与答

go 如何做到取出一个包的所有结构体和函数?

okki · · 3588 次点击
有这么个问题, 给你一个包,名字叫"apps", 你只知道包下有很多结构体和函数, 问:如何做到把这个包的所以结构体和函数取出来?
你这个 类似于 IDE 的功能了
#3
更多评论
你所说的"取出来"到底是什么概念? 什么地方需要用到这个东西? 给个链接, 不知道能不能帮你[get-all-info-about-a-package-via-importer-and-reflect](https://stackoverflow.com/questions/47088551/get-all-info-about-a-package-via-importer-and-reflect)
#1
用这个包 https://golang.org/pkg/go/ 由于你实际用途不同 可能分别会用到 go/types 以及 go/ast
#2

用户登录

没有账号?注册

今日阅读排行

    加载中

一周阅读排行

    加载中